So, 'Revenge' from 1980. It’s got this raw atmosphere, you know? The pacing ebbs and flows, mirroring the protagonist's spiraling emotions. The story dives into family dynamics and the impact of choices, which feels pretty heavy. The performances are quite solid, especially for a lesser-known film—there's a genuine sense of struggle. Practical effects aren't the focus, but they do add a layer of realism when things get intense. What really stands out is the way it captures the confusion of adolescence, making you reflect on how relationships shape our paths. It's not flashy, but there's something to appreciate in its sincerity and depth.
